Yep, this is the hard water glass cleaner
Admittedly, I'm not a house cleaner. I don't enjoy it. I procrastinate. We also have very hard water. My husband ripped out our entire master bathroom and I picked out these pretty glass sliding doors, instead of the tacky frosted ones we had from the prior owners. I assumed you kept glass clean with Windex. Ha! Not with hard water! Hard water drops WILL NOT WIPE CLEAN! Googling got me to a semi-decent product by Lysol. Yes, it did remove most of the water spots whenever I cleaned. The issue is it started to evaporate while I was still scrubbing with my scratchy surfaced sponge and since the entire door and panel was being scrubbed, you couldn't see what you were accomplishing. It looked like you scrubbed all of the surface, but when you sprayed the area down, there were patches of hard water spots that needed additional scrubbing. It was very frustrating! Somehow I found this Bio-clean product on Amazon. Ouch on that price! I got the bigger bottle to at least get a better value. This product works! I still used the same scratchy surfaced kitchen sponge for cleaning. I think one of the reasons that it works is that it's a cream. You wipe it on and it mostly stays on (with a tad bit of evaporation) until you can rinse it off so it can continue breaking down those mineral deposits. The product rinsed cleanly away using the shower nozzle. Instead of going over the rinsed glass with a microfiber cloth, Windex, and my tears to find missed patches of mineral deposits, I only used a dry microfiber cloth to wipe the glass dry instead of an additional glass cleaner. I promptly got on Amazon to leave this review & order more for fear that it'll no longer be available. The price? That brings a few tears. But personally, I will save Bio-clean for tough jobs only, such as the shower glass doors. My boys' shower / tub will get the regular cleaner. I won't waste it on regular cleaning jobs due to the cost. If the cost were to come down, it's definitely a product I'd use more widely across my home.

I've had a particularly difficult hard water stripe that has formed over the years where the sliding shower door overlaps the fixed glass pain. Hazy, streaked and typical hard water deposit ... but not super rough because I've attempted to clean it at least 5 times in the past with various purchased remedies as well as multiple homemade concoctions recommended and essentially polished it. They 'helped' but never eliminated it. I tried this Bioclean remover along with a single Scotch Brite Zero Scratch pad in combination. A small bucket of water to maintain a moist sponge and deliberate circular strokes with the scrubber side, with consistent pressure. I made multiple passes over the area and didn't let it dry. The proof is always after you get done and it all dries. Every time in the past, it looks great at first and then the haze comes back - not this time! I missed a couple of areas but retreated and the glass looks almost new again. Even the heaviest deposits at the base were gone. The photo shows the 'after' effects. There was a long 1" - 2" hard water stripe from the base to about 3/4 of the way up. The product smells like wintergreen and is somewhat creamy, a bit like soft-scrub. I'm not sure what the active chemicals are in it or if it's the soft abrasive nature from the combination o the cleaner and the sponge, but I don't care. After trying so many different combinations of homemade and purchased cleaners, this is the one! Highly, highly recommend this product.

I was skeptical, but this stuff genuinely impressed me!
I have years of hard water/mineral buildup on my exterior windows, and after trying multiple glass cleaners with little success, I decided to give Bio-Clean a try with #0000 steel wool. The difference was dramatic. One of my windows went from looking permanently cloudy to about 80% clear after one session. This isn’t a miracle product—you still need some elbow grease, and heavy mineral deposits won’t disappear with a quick wipe—but it actually removes buildup that regular glass cleaners won’t touch. A little product goes a long way, and it was easy to work with. If you’re dealing with hard water stains, I’d absolutely recommend giving this a try before assuming your glass is permanently etched or replacing your windows. It saved one of my windows, and I’m now working through the rest of the house.
